BEGIN:VCALENDAR
VERSION:2.0
PRODID:-//https://techplay.jp//JP
CALSCALE:GREGORIAN
METHOD:PUBLISH
X-WR-CALDESC:レガシーコード改革！UT/CIでWebサービスの技術
 的負債を解消する取り組み
X-WR-CALNAME:レガシーコード改革！UT/CIでWebサービスの技術
 的負債を解消する取り組み
X-WR-TIMEZONE:Asia/Tokyo
BEGIN:VTIMEZONE
TZID:Asia/Tokyo
BEGIN:STANDARD
DTSTART:19700101T000000
TZOFFSETFROM:+0900
TZOFFSETTO:+0900
TZNAME:JST
END:STANDARD
END:VTIMEZONE
BEGIN:VEVENT
UID:684497@techplay.jp
SUMMARY:レガシーコード改革！UT/CIでWebサービスの技術的
 負債を解消する取り組み
DTSTART;TZID=Asia/Tokyo:20180807T193000
DTEND;TZID=Asia/Tokyo:20180807T213000
DTSTAMP:20260410T082932Z
CREATED:20180711T020036Z
DESCRIPTION:イベント詳細はこちら\nhttps://techplay.jp/event/68449
 7?utm_medium=referral&utm_source=ics&utm_campaign=ics\n\n今回は、ラ
 ンサーズ、ReBuild、BASEの3社より、各社がどのようにし
 て技術的負債と向き合い変革を進めてきたのか、その
 成功と失敗を赤裸々にお話しいたします！Laravel・CakePH
 Pなどフレームワークを用いたアプリケーションに対す
 るCIによるユニットテスト・静的解析の自動実行など
 、具体的な取り組みについてもご紹介いたします。\n\n
 軽食や飲み物もご用意しております！カジュアルな雰
 囲気で情報交換ができる場になればと思っております
 ので、ぜひお気軽にお越しください！\n\n登壇者プロフ
 ィール と 発表内容概要\n\nBASE株式会社　東口 和暉（
 ひがしぐち かずき）\n\nBASE Product Division サーバーサイ
 ドエンジニア\n\n同志社大学経済学部卒。大学在学中に
 インターンやアルバイト・受託にてウェブアプリケー
 ション開発を経験し、東京のITベンチャー企業に新卒
 入社。EC・POSシステムのプロジェクト管理・要件定義
 ・基本設計・保守開発などを経験。2017年10月にBASE株式
 会社に入社。BASE Product Divisionにおいて、Eコマースプラ
 ットフォーム「BASE」の決済領域の開発やPHP・CakePHPの
 バージョンアップなどに従事している。\n\n登壇内容に
 ついて\n\n「決済リプレイスとPHPバージョンアップを支
 えたユニットテスト」\n\nBASEでは、昨年度からPHPUnitに
 よるユニットテストを書いてきており、特にPHPバージ
 ョンアップや機能改修などに書いてきました。今回は
 、決済リプレイスとPHPバージョンアップを行ってきた
 際に得た具体的な知見について発表します。テストを
 書き始めた当時のスタンスや、既存コードに対する仕
 様化テスト、外部連携を絡む処理のテストや、テスト
 が増えてきたために起きたfixuteの複雑化などについて
 お話しします。\n\n株式会社ReBuild　嘉数 侑起（かかず 
 ゆうき）\n\n1990年沖縄県生まれ。琉球大学大学院理工
 学研究科卒。大学院卒業後、2016年に沖縄電力のITを担
 う沖電グローバルシステムズ株式会社に入社し、制御
 系プログラミングやインフラ構築、セキュリティに関
 する仕事に従事。2018年現在は株式会社Re:Buildに所属し
 、前職で培ってきたインフラ周りの技術を活かしつつW
 ebエンジニアとして活動している。開発では使用して
 いる言語は主にPHP（Laravel5）やJavaScript（Vue.js）など。\
 n\n登壇内容について\n\n「Laravel5.5的継続的インテグレ
 ーション」\n\nRe:Buildは、まだ会社を立ち上げたばかり
 というのもあり、少ないメンバーで開発を行っていま
 す。その中で品質を担保しつつ、より開発に集中する
 為にユニットテストを書いて、CIを回しています。具
 体的にはLaravel5.5で開発する中で、gitlab上でPHPUnit(ユニ
 ットテスト)とPHPstan(静的解析)をCIで回し、品質担保を
 しています。発表の中では、導入方法やどのような点
 が効率化されたかなどをお話します。\n\nランサーズ株
 式会社 永田 真也（ながた しんや）\n\n1980年生まれ。
 静岡大学情報学部卒業。同大学院情報学研究科修了後
 、新卒入社したWeb系の受託開発会社を経て2013年6月に
 ランサーズ株式会社にジョイン。主にPHP/CakePHPでのサ
 ーバーサイド開発を中心に、開発プロセス改善、採用
 、パートナー契約/管理、部署横断プロジェクトなど幅
 広く担当。現在は、プロダクト開発に携わりながら、
 新卒エンジニア採用をメインに担当。研修/育成プログ
 ラムを企画/実施して入社数ヶ月で即戦力となる新卒エ
 ンジニアの育成に取り組んでいる。\n\n登壇内容につい
 て\n\n「レジェンドコードと向き合いレガシーからモダ
 ンへ変革する」\n\n「Lancers」はローンチから10年が経過
 し、これまでのシステムの延長線上ではなく、時代を
 リードするシステムに抜本的に変革をしていく必要が
 あります。蓄積していく技術負債を解決すべく様々な
 施策にチャレンジしてきましたが、最初からうまくい
 ったわけではなく、むしろ多くの失敗を経験していま
 す。重要事項にフォーカスし、やらないことを決める
 ことで一歩ずつ前に進み、新しい技術の導入も推進し
 ていくことを現在進行形で試みています。過去の失敗
 事例(アンチパターン)も踏まえ、どういう経緯で現在
 に至り、今後の変革を進めていくかという話をできれ
 ばと思います。\n\nイベント概要\n\n開催予定日時\n\n開
 場：19:30 　開催時間：20:00～21:45 予定\n\nアジェンダ\n\n
 \n\n\n  時間\n  内容\n  登壇者\n\n\n\n\n  19：00～\n  受付開
 始\n  \n\n\n  19：30～\n  オープニング\n  \n\n\n  19：35～19
 ：55\n  LT枠①「決済リプレイスとPHPバージョンアップ
 を支えたユニットテスト」\n  BASE株式会社 東口\n\n\n  19
 ：55～20：15\n  LT枠②「Laravel5.5的継続的インテグレーシ
 ョン」\n  株式会社ReBuild 嘉数\n\n\n  20：15～20：35\n  LT枠
 ③「レジェンドコードと向き合いレガシーからモダン
 へ変革する」\n  ランサーズ株式会社 永田\n\n\n  20：35
 ～21：30\n  懇親会\n  \n\n\n  21：30\n  イベント終了\n  \n\n\
 n\n\n開催場所\n\n「hoops link tokyo」\n〒150-0042 東京都渋谷
 区宇田川町28-4 三井住友銀行　渋谷西ビル6階　　\n\n《
 ※※迷われる方が多くいらっしゃいます！※※》\n会
 場があるビルの1Fは、三井住友銀行のATMです！\nそのま
 まATMに入っていただき、ATM横のエレベーターより6階に
 お上がりください。\n\n参加費\n\n無料\n\n参加対象\n\nエ
 ンジニア\n\n持ち物\n\nお名刺\n※ 受付の際の本人確認
 で利用させていただきます。\n\n申込締め切り\n\n2018/8/3
 (金)23:00\n※当選された方のみご連絡差し上げます。\n\n
 注意事項\n\n※イベントの内容は、予告なく変更となる
 可能性がございます。予めご了承ください。※ イベン
 ト開催中は撮影を行います。写真はSNS等で公開する可
 能性がありますので、あらかじめご了承ください。 ※
  補欠者の方は、ご来場いただいてもご入場いただくこ
 とが出来ませんのでご了承ください。※ 抽選制のイベ
 ントですので、欠席される場合はお手数ですが速やか
 にキャンセル処理をお願い致します。\n\n主催\n\nBASE株
 式会社\n\n\n
LOCATION:hoops link tokyo 〒150-0042 東京都渋谷区宇田川町28-4　
 三井住友銀行 渋谷西ビル6階
URL:https://techplay.jp/event/684497?utm_medium=referral&utm_source=ics&utm
 _campaign=ics
END:VEVENT
END:VCALENDAR
